The lazy days of summer are officially over. No longer can one spend a whole day on YouTube and eating a bag of marshmallows. Free time is simply too precious now. With Friday nights always booked up, and Sunday nights marked the unofficial homework time, it is important to make the most of the small free parts of the weekend.
Fall is when there are the most opportunities to be outside, because the weather is cool, but not too cold. It’s perfect for bike-riding and walking.
Saturday nights are always fun, out with friends, et cetera, but usually Saturday afternoon is an empty timeslot. After all, who does homework on a Saturday? So round up your friends and have a picnic in the park a la elementary school! Pack easy, fun foods like peanut butter and jelly sandwiches, grapes, and brownies. Afterwards, take funny pictures on the slides and swings.
Don’t feel like going out? Host a TV show night! Rent a favorite TV show, order pizza, make some popcorn, and have a marathon. Can’t decide on a TV show? The Office and Friends are universal favorites.

Have a scavenger hunt! Get a big group of friends together, come up with a random list of objects, and divide into teams. The team to find all of the objects first wins, and the losing teams buy dinner!
Check out some art. After your gallery walk, check out a local café for a coffee, tea, or smoothie.
Even though summer is greatly missed, and taking time totally for granted was an amazing luxury, entertaining weekends still exist! So enjoy school as much as possible, make the most of your weekend, and take pleasure in the thought that summer is only…eight months away!
